Responsibilities
~2 min readAs a Veterinary Assistant, youâll be an important part of the day-to-day flow of our clinic. Youâll help keep our patients comfortable, our clients informed, and our team running smoothly.
- âConnect with clients: Communicate clearly and compassionately with pet parents, answer questions, provide education, and help clients understand their petâs treatment and care. We want every client to leave feeling informedânot overwhelmed.
- âSupport patient care: Assist with implementing treatment plans recommended by our veterinarians and help provide the hands-on care our patients need. From routine appointments to those âokay, today is BUSYâ moments, youâll play an important role in keeping patients safe and comfortable.
- âBe a team player: Work closely with veterinarians and fellow team members to create a consistent, organized, and supportive patient-care experience. We believe the best clinics are built by people who communicate, help each other out, and genuinely have each otherâs backs.
- âKeep things moving: Help with the many behind-the-scenes tasks that keep a veterinary clinic running efficiently. Organization, attention to detail, and being willing to jump in wherever needed are HUGE.
- âBe an advocate for pets: Help make every patientâs visit as positive and stress-free as possible. Because letâs be honest, they didnât exactly volunteer to come to the vet. đ
